Wednesday just wasn't the day for Oak Lawn's offense. They might be feeling deja-vu: they lost 3-0 to the Reavis Rams, which was the same score (and result) they got the week prior. Oak Lawn just can't catch a break and has now endured three losses in a row.
Oak Lawn had to settle for second despite strong performances on the mound from Eli Kulpinski and Manny Rangel Kulpinski pitched two innings while giving up no earned runs off one hit, while Rangel tossed two innings while giving up no earned runs off one hit. Rangel has been consistent recently: he hasn't given up more than two walks in six consecutive pitching appearances.
Oak Lawn's defeat dropped their record down to 12-14. As for Reavis, they have been performing incredibly well recently as they've won 17 of their last 18 games, which provided a nice bump to their 27-4 record this season.
Oak Lawn will head out on the road to take on Bremen at 4:30 p.m. on Thursday. As for Reavis, they will be playing in front of their home fans against Hillcrest at 4:30 p.m. on Thursday.
